Comet Wirtanen Passes by the Earth
Image Credit & Copyright: Ruslan Merzlyakov [3] (RMS Photography [4] )
Explanation: Today Comet Wirtanen passes by the Earth. The kilometer-sized
dirty snowball orbits the Sun every 5.4 years, ranging as far out as Jupiter
[5] and as close in as the Earth [6] . Today Comet 46P/Wirtanen [7] passes
within only 31 lunar distances to the Earth, the closest approach in 70 years.
If you know where to look [8] (Taurus), you can see the comet [9] through
binoculars as an unusual blue smudge [10] . Pictured [11] a week ago, Comet
Wirtanen was photographed in the sky beyond an old abandoned church in Skagen
[12] , Denmark [13] . The image composite also captures the astrophotographer.
After today [14] , the comet will begin to fade as it [15] recedes from the
Earth and the Sun.
